Tooth Extraction Treatment
If you require a tooth extraction, you can expect a knowledgeable dental doctor to meticulously and masterfully eliminate your tooth utilizing specialized tools and strategies.
Initially, the oral surgeon will administer a local anesthetic to numb the location around the tooth. This makes sure that you will not feel any discomfort during the procedure.
Next, the doctor will certainly utilize a device called an elevator to loosen the tooth from its outlet. Once the tooth is adequately loosened up, the doctor will certainly make use of forceps to hold and carefully shake the tooth to and fro until it can be lifted out. In some cases, the tooth may need to be separated right into smaller pieces for less complicated elimination.
Dental Implant Surgical Procedure
Throughout oral implant surgical procedure, an oral surgeon will carefully position a titanium implant into your jawbone to work as a replacement for a missing tooth. This procedure is normally executed under regional anesthesia to ensure your convenience throughout the procedure.
The very first step includes making a laceration in your periodontal to subject the jawbone. After that, a hole is pierced right into the bone to create space for the dental implant. The dental implant is after that placed into the hole and secured in position.
With time, the implant fuses with the bone via a process called osseointegration, supplying a steady structure for the substitute tooth.
